The fit is snug but not tight. The carbon fiber plate provides that classic, supportive feel Jordan 11s are known for. They're not ultra-light, but you feel stable. The cushioning isn't super plush by today's standards, but it's responsive. A solid, classic on-foot feel overall. Okay, let's get these out of the box. First impression? The "air jordan 11 cool grey" is just.. clean. The mix of that light grey patent leather with the matte mesh is so sharp. For $225, the build quality feels solid right away - no glue stains or anything funky. It's a timeless look that, honestly, works with almost anything in your closet. Who might want to skip? If you're on a tight budget, there are more affordable options. Hardcore ballers looking for modern performance tech should probably look elsewhere (this is a 90s design, after all). And if you absolutely hate seeing creases on your patent leather... maybe admire these from afar. Comparing it to my Bred 11s, the 'Cool Grey' feels like the more wearable, everyday version. The absence of a stark color contrast makes it incredibly versatile. The advantage? You can rock these with jeans, shorts, even smarter-casual looks. The downside? That pristine patent leather can be a magnet for scuffs if you're not careful!
